When it comes to planning your dream vacation in South Africa, the picturesque town of Underberg should be at the top of your list. Nestled in the heart of the Southern Drakensberg Mountains, Underberg offers a serene escape for travelers seeking both adventure and tranquility. 1. Fly Fishing in Pristine Waters:
Underberg is a paradise for fly fishing enthusiasts. With its crystal-clear rivers and lakes surrounded by lush landscapes, you’ll have the perfect backdrop for casting your line. Whether you’re a seasoned angler or a beginner, the local guides can help you reel in trout and yellowfish. Don’t forget to check out the annual Trout Fishing Festival for some friendly competition.
2. Conquer the Sani Pass:
For those seeking a thrilling adventure, a journey up the Sani Pass is a must. This rugged mountain road takes you to the highest pub in Africa, perched at an elevation of 2,874 meters. The breathtaking views along the way are worth every twist and turn. Before you embark on this adventure, remember to bring your passports, as you’ll be crossing into Lesotho. The drive to the pub at the top takes approximately 1 hour, and once you reach the summit, enjoy a warm meal and a cold drink at the Sani Mountain Lodge while taking in the stunning vistas of Lesotho.
3. Explore the Maloti-Drakensberg Transfrontier Park:
Nature enthusiasts will be in their element in the Maloti-Drakensberg Transfrontier Park, a UNESCO World Heritage Site. This vast wilderness area offers a network of hiking trails, providing opportunities to spot unique flora and fauna. The park is also home to a rich collection of San rock art, offering a glimpse into the region’s ancient history.
4. Immerse Yourself in Music at Splashy Fen:
If you’re visiting Underberg during the Easter weekend, don’t miss Splashy Fen, South Africa’s longest-running music festival. Set against the backdrop of the Drakensberg Mountains, this festival features an eclectic lineup of local and international artists across multiple stages. It’s the perfect blend of music, nature, and community, creating an unforgettable experience.
